Abstract

The study utilized descriptive design which endeavors to examine and evaluate the music instruction in the Special Program in the Arts in selected SPA schools in Region X. The participants of study were all the Grade 9 SPA Music students in the selected SPA schools in Region X, during the school year 2019-2020. The researcher used two (2) sets of assessment tools to evaluate knowledge on music theory and singing ability of students. The first set of tool is a written examination and the second set is a Scoring Rubrics to rate (Dep Ed Order No 73, s. 2012) the singing ability of the students. Three music experts evaluated the students? singing ability using rubrics. The students were rated according to given criteria such as melody, rhythm, timbre, and dynamics. Students were also rated for musicianship and stage presence. Most of the student-respondents mastered the Intensity level of sound/music and they also Mastered the minor/major scale pattern. A clear evident that after seventeen years of implementation of SPA Music Program, teachers and administrator enhance their teaching-learning styles to suit the needs of the students. The students? performance in music theory is approaching proficient indicates that the SPA Music Program is well-organized and still progressing. This dissertation sheds light on the Department of Education to strengthen its instructions, guidelines, and policies on the Special Program in the Arts.
